    Navalny's legacy – The Washington Post

    It was Alexei Navalny A charismatic and outspoken critic of the Kremlin More than a decade ago, he was the target of an assassination attempt. Last year, Navalny was sentenced to 19 years in prison for “extremism,” but he was seen He is alive and appears healthy Just a few days before his death. President Biden condemned Navalny's death as “evidence of Putin's brutality.”

    So said The Post's David M. Herszenhorn Written extensively About Navalny's career and activity. Herzenhorn joins Post Reports to talk about Navalny's legacy, and what the Russian political landscape might look like without him.
